O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ES

The objects of the Trust are to advance the Christian faith in accordance with the Statement of Beliefs appearing in the Schedule hereto in Chippenham and in such other parts of the United Kingdom or the world as the Trustees may from time to time think fit and to fulfil such other purposes which are exclusively charitable according to the law of England and Wales and are connected with the charitable work of the charity.

The Church is not a building, but a gathering of ordinary people of different ages and backgrounds, whose lives have been changed by Jesus Christ, the Son of God. The New Testament reveals the Church as a community of people, properly taught and cared for, who by loving and serving Jesus Christ, were also committed to love and care for each other and to bring a blessing to the area in which they lived. Trinity Chippenham; its trustees, elders, and those who participate in the church community are committed to the restoration of those New Testament principles. It is not alone in this, it is one of many Churches in the area, country and all over the world that is re-discovering the excitement of knowing Jesus Christ. The vision is to see the people of Chippenham come to discover the transforming delight of the love of the Trinity that is found in relationship with Jesus as Lord, Saviour and friend.

Trinity Chippenham meets every Sunday, with children’s programmes running simultaneously for children up to age 11. Trinity Chippenham also continues a midweek youth group and Life Groups, meeting in homes of church members to study the Bible, encourage one another and praying together. All activities are listed on www.trinitychippenham.org. The church maintains a close working relationship with the Chippenham CAP Centre (CC#1192100), which was launched by Trinity Chippenham in 2021. ACHIEVEMENTS AND PERFORMANCE

Trinity Chippenham continued to meet during 2023 and continued a normal and full church programme throughout the year. The Sunday gathering met each week with contemporaneous children’s work (TC Kids and TC Tots).

Life Groups continued during the year, with new groups being launched, bringing the total to six by year end. Other informal gatherings, and special one-off gatherings also took place, as listed above. The youth group met midweek most weeks, continuing to meet in rented space for their gatherings due to increasing numbers. All special events were well attended by guests. We did not charge entry to these or any events in 2023.

The church website, www.trinitychippenham.org, remained live throughout the year offering information about the church, as well as recordings of church sermons for the public to access without charge.

FINANCIAL REVIEW

Trinity Chippenham does not have a reserves policy. Trinity Chippenham raises its funds by discreet offerings from participants, many of whom choose to give by direct debit each month into the church bank account. We do not charge for participation in the normal programme of church events, and we do not pass an offering receptacle during any church gatherings.
